首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

如何在fortran中添加双精度制表符?

在Fortran中,可以使用特定的格式化输出语句来添加双精度制表符。以下是一个示例代码:

代码语言:txt
复制
program add_tab
  implicit none
  
  real(kind=8) :: num1, num2, result
  
  ! 输入双精度数值
  write(*, *) "请输入两个双精度数值:"
  read(*, *) num1, num2
  
  ! 计算结果
  result = num1 + num2
  
  ! 输出结果,并使用制表符对齐
  write(*, '(F12.2, A, F12.2)') num1, CHAR(9), num2
  write(*, '(A, F12.2)') "结果:", result
  
end program add_tab

在上述代码中,使用了CHAR(9)来表示制表符,它的ASCII码值为9。在格式化输出语句中,使用'(F12.2, A, F12.2)'来指定输出格式,其中F12.2表示输出双精度数值,保留两位小数,A表示输出制表符,'(A, F12.2)'表示输出字符串和双精度数值。

这样,当程序执行时,输入的两个双精度数值将以制表符对齐的形式输出。

请注意,本回答中没有提及具体的腾讯云产品和产品介绍链接地址,因为与Fortran添加双精度制表符无直接关联。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

何在keras添加自己的优化器(adam等)

Anaconda3\envs\tensorflow-gpu\Lib\site-packages\tensorflow\python\keras 3、找到keras目录下的optimizers.py文件并添加自己的优化器...找到optimizers.py的adam等优化器类并在后面添加自己的优化器类 以本文来说,我在第718行添加如下代码 @tf_export('keras.optimizers.adamsss') class...Adamsss, self).get_config() return dict(list(base_config.items()) + list(config.items())) 然后修改之后的优化器调用类添加我自己的优化器...# 传入优化器名称: 默认参数将被采用 model.compile(loss=’mean_squared_error’, optimizer=’sgd’) 以上这篇如何在keras添加自己的优化器...(adam等)就是小编分享给大家的全部内容了,希望能给大家一个参考。

44.9K30

Matlab C混合编程

MATLAB引擎程序指的是那些通过管道(在UNIX系统)或者ActiveX(在Windows系统)与独立MATLAB进程进行通信的C/C++或者Fortran程序。...(复)精度矩阵: MATLAB中最常用的数据类型便是(复)精度、非稀疏矩阵,这些矩阵的元素都是精度(double)的,矩阵的尺寸为m×n,其中m是总行数,m是总列数。...矩阵数据实际存放在两个精度向量——一个向量存放的是数据的实部,另一个向量存放的是数据的虚部。...如果一个矩阵的pi为空的话,说明它是实精度矩阵。 稀疏矩阵(Sparse Matrices) MATLAB稀疏矩阵的存储格式与众不同。...如果nnz小于nzmax,可以继续向矩阵添加非零项而无需分配额外的存储空间< 4、主要函数举例: ·MATFile *matOpen(const char *filename, const char

1.4K20

【Java基础教程】标识符与关键字

Java8 也作用于声明接口函数的默认实现 do 用在do-while循环结构 double 基本数据类型之一,精度浮点数类型 else 用在条件语句中,表明当条件不成立时的分支 enum 枚举...用来测试一个对象是否是指定类型的实例对象 int 基本数据类型之一,整数类型 interface 接口 long 基本数据类型之一,长整数类型 native 用来声明一个方法是由与计算机相关的语言(C.../C++/FORTRAN语言)实现的 new 用来创建新实例对象 package 包 private 一种访问控制方式:私用模式 protected 一种访问控制方式:保护模式 public 一种访问控制方式...:共用模式 return 从成员方法返回数据 short 基本数据类型之一,短整数类型 static 表明具有静态属性 strictfp 用来声明FP_strict(单精度精度浮点数)表达式遵循[...扩展 Java注释 添加注释是为了提高程序的可读性,帮助自己和读者理解整个内容 那么Java如何添加注释 有两种方法 第一种方法:使用// 一般用于单行注释 public class User

58820

CC++文字常量与常变量

实型常量包括单精度浮点数(float)、精度浮点数(double)和长精度浮点数(long double),表示形式有科学计数法和非科学计数法。...int a=4; //4为数值常量的整型常量 float b=4.4; //4.4为数值常量精度实型常量 double c=1.4e10; //1.4e5...表示的值为1.4×10^5,是数值常量精度实型常量 字符常量:指ASCII字符,有128个,分为普通字符和转义字符。...普通字符指可直接书写的字符,’a’和’b’。转义字符指不能直接书写的特殊字符,需要使用反斜杠进行表示,比如’\t’表示水平制表符,’\v’表示垂直制表符。...cout<<&”hello world”<<endl; //打印输出字符串常量”hello world”存储地址 常变量在C/C++由const关键字来定义,分为全局常变量和局部常变量。

1.6K31

C++基础知识一

return:当该语句包括一个值时,此返回值的类型必须与函数的返回类型相容,如下所示: 添加描述 在上述例子,main的返回类型是int,而返回值0的确是一个int类型的值 。...内置类型:有语言定义的类型,int。 类:一种用于定义自己的数据结构及其相关操作的机制。标准库类型istream何ostream都是类。 类类型:类定义的类型,类名即为类型名。...———>6位有效数 double———>精度浮点数———>10位有效数 long double—>扩展精度浮点数——>10位有效数 布尔类型(bool)的取值是真(true)或者假(false)。...C++转义序列 转行符———>\n          横向制表符———>\t        报警(响铃)符———>\a 退格符———>\n          纵向制表符———>\t        双引号...双引号———>\’ 回车符———>\r            进纸符———>\f     C++关键字 添加描述 C++操作符替代名 添加描述 指针与引用 添加描述 空指针不指向任何对象。

78800

精度数值运算解病态方程组

针对病态方程组对任何算法都将产生数值不稳定性,可采用高精度数值运算解决这个问题。 Fortran内置函数SELECTED_REAL_KIND(p, r),默认两个参数p是精度,r是范围。...p是所需精度的十进制数值,r是以10^r次方表示的所需数值的范围。当执行该函数的时候,会返回达到或者超过指定精度或者范围的的实型数据的最小类别参数。使用该函数可以保持程序通用性,而不受平台限制。...注意程序第二个变量所需的精度为13位小数和10^200次方的范围,但是处理器实际分配的精度为15位小数和10^308次方的范围. ●算例 ? 采用的精度计算,结果为: ?...采用精度计算,结果为: ? 更复杂的方程组可以用函数SELECTED_REAL_KIND选择所需精度

1.1K20

「译文」给讨厌YAML的人的10个写YAML的建议

成功是无声的,所以如果您想要基于 lint 的成功的反馈,您可以添加一个带&号(&&)的有条件的第二个命令。...只需将您的 JSON 数据写入 Python 变量,在导入语句前面添加一个 import 语句,并以一个简单的三行输出语句结束文件。 #!...解决空格和制表符的争论 好吧,也许您不能确定地解决空格 vs. 制表符的争论[12],但您至少应该在您的项目或组织解决这个争论。...任何好的文本编辑器都允许定义多个空格而不是制表符,所以这个选择不会对 tab 键的粉丝产生负面影响。 您可能非常清楚,制表符和空格本质上是不可见的。...如果您发现自己一次又一次地犯 YAML 文档错误,您可以将配方或模板作为注释部分嵌入到 YAML 文件。当您添加一个节时,复制注释的配方并使用新的真实数据覆盖虚拟数据。

1.4K30

1.1 关键字与保留字

表明类或者成员方法具有抽象属性 final 用来说明最终属性,表明一个类不能派生出子类,或者成员方法不能被覆盖,或者成员域的值不能被改变,用来定义常量 native 用来声明一个方法是由与计算机相关的语言(C.../C++/FORTRAN语言)实现的 private 一种访问控制方式:私用模式 protected 一种访问控制方式:保护模式 public 一种访问控制方式:共用模式 static 表明具有静态属性...double 基本数据类型之一,精度浮点数类型 流程控制 break 提前跳出一个块 case 用在switch语句之中,表示其中的一个分支 continue 回到一个块的开始处 default...Java8 也作用于声明接口函数的默认实现 for 一种循环结构的引导词 do 用在do-while循环结构 while 用在循环结构 if 条件语句的引导词 else 用在条件语句中,...声明在当前定义的成员方法中所有需要抛出的异常 操作符 instanceof 用来测试一个对象是否是指定类型的实例对象 assert 断言,用来进行程序调试 strictfp 用来声明FP_strict(单精度精度浮点数

13610

【愚公系列】2021年12月 Java教学课程 05-关键字

Java8 也作用于声明接口函数的默认实现 do 用在do-while循环结构 double 基本数据类型之一,精度浮点数类型 else 用在条件语句中,表明当条件不成立时的分支 enum 枚举...用来测试一个对象是否是指定类型的实例对象 int 基本数据类型之一,整数类型 interface 接口 long 基本数据类型之一,长整数类型 native 用来声明一个方法是由与计算机相关的语言(C.../C++/FORTRAN语言)实现的 new 用来创建新实例对象 package 包 private 一种访问控制方式:私用模式 protected 一种访问控制方式:保护模式 public 一种访问控制方式...:共用模式 return 从成员方法返回数据 short 基本数据类型之一,短整数类型 static 表明具有静态属性 strictfp 用来声明FP_strict(单精度精度浮点数)表达式遵循IEEE...还有些关键字, future、 generic、 operator、 outer、rest、var等都是Java保留的没有意义的关键字。

23430

讲解Invalid character escape o.

讲解Invalid character escape '\o'在编程,我们经常遇到需要在字符串插入一些特殊字符的情况。对于某些字符,我们可以直接在字符串中使用它们,'a'、'b'等。...在字符串,反斜杠\被用作转义字符的前缀,用来表示一些特殊字符。例如,\n代表换行符,\t代表制表符,\\"代表双引号等。通过使用转义字符,我们可以在字符串插入这些特殊字符。...下面是一个示例,展示了如何在Python解决"Invalid character escape '\o'"的问题:pythonCopy code# 使用反斜杠来解决无效字符转义问题invalid_string...在实际开发,我们经常需要使用文件路径来进行文件操作,读取、写入等。通过正确处理转义字符,我们可以避免由于无效的转义序列导致的错误,并确保正确地构建出文件路径。...下面是一些常用的字符转义序列及其含义:\n:换行符(Newline),表示字符串换行的位置。\t:制表符(Tab),表示字符串制表的位置。

27310

java的关键字有哪些_java关键字有哪些?java关键字大全

Java8 也作用于声明接口函数的默认实现  13、do-用在do-while循环结构  14、double-基本数据类型之一,精度浮点数类型  15、else-用在条件语句中,表明当条件不成立时的分支...表明一个类不能派生出子类,或者成员方法不能被覆盖,或者成员域的值不能被改变,用来定义常量  19、finally-用于处理异常情况,用来声明一个基本肯定会被执行到的语句块  20、float-基本数据类型之一,单精度浮点数类型...用来测试一个对象是否是指定类型的实例对象  27、int-基本数据类型之一,整数类型  28、interface-接口  29、long-基本数据类型之一,长整数类型  30、native-用来声明一个方法是由与计算机相关的语言(C.../C++/FORTRAN语言)实现的  31、new-用来创建新实例对象  32、package-包  33、private-一种访问控制方式:私用模式  34、protected-一种访问控制方式:保护模式...-用来声明FP_strict(单精度精度浮点数)表达式遵循IEEE 754算术规范  40、super-表明当前对象的父类型的引用或者父类型的构造方法  41、switch-分支语句结构的引导词

2.5K40

java的关键字有哪些_java关键字有哪些?java关键字大全

Java8 也作用于声明接口函数的默认实现 13、do-用在do-while循环结构 14、double-基本数据类型之一,精度浮点数类型 15、else-用在条件语句中,表明当条件不成立时的分支...表明一个类不能派生出子类,或者成员方法不能被覆盖,或者成员域的值不能被改变,用来定义常量 19、finally-用于处理异常情况,用来声明一个基本肯定会被执行到的语句块 20、float-基本数据类型之一,单精度浮点数类型...用来测试一个对象是否是指定类型的实例对象 27、int-基本数据类型之一,整数类型 28、interface-接口 29、long-基本数据类型之一,长整数类型 30、native-用来声明一个方法是由与计算机相关的语言(C.../C++/FORTRAN语言)实现的 31、new-用来创建新实例对象 32、package-包 33、private-一种访问控制方式:私用模式 34、protected-一种访问控制方式:保护模式...FP_strict(单精度精度浮点数)表达式遵循IEEE 754算术规范 40、super-表明当前对象的父类型的引用或者父类型的构造方法 41、switch-分支语句结构的引导词 42、synchronized

76320

论文导读 | 性能与生产力 : Rust vs C语言

此外,为了提高响应时间,语言应该提供工具或库,允许扩展基础语言功能,为多处理器架构提供并发和并行处理能力,包括共享(OpenMP)和分布式内存(OpenMPI或MPICH)。...在单精度方面,C语言版本在所有问题规模上都优于Rust,实现了高达1.18倍的改进,而在精度方面,两种实现的性能几乎相同。...这种行为在精度没有被复制,在精度两种代码是非常相似的。 这些优化还没有包含在 Rust 的稳定版本,所以这一点有望在未来得到改善。 编程效能 有很多方法来衡量编程的成本,包括计算代码行数。...Rust 添加外部库非常方便,比如数学优化库或 rayon库。C 则比较麻烦。 实验结论 先来看一下论文结论。 Rust 创建的 N-Body 优化算法是从一个基础版本开始,然后不断迭代优化出来的。...在精度方面,性能结果很接近,但在单精度方面,C版本的性能要好一些。这是因为Rust对这种数据类型的数学运算的优化不如C语言好。

2.5K30
领券